How to Redeem Codes in Game of Evolution Without a Hitch

Look, if you’ve been around mobile games for a while, you already know—most games don’t exactly roll out the red carpet when it comes to code redemption. The UI is clunky, the labels change every other update, and half the time the “redeem” button is buried under five menus. Game of Evolution is no different, but once you know the path, it’s painless.

Step-by-Step: Redeem Your Codes Like a Pro

Here’s how you do it, clean and simple:

  1. Launch the game and wait for the main screen to load fully.
  2. Tap the gear icon (⚙️) in the top-right corner—that’s your settings menu.
  3. Scroll down until you see “Gift Code” or “Promo Code”—the label sometimes changes depending on your version.
  4. Tap it, then paste your code exactly as it appears—don’t mess around with spacing or lowercase.
  5. Hit “Confirm” or “Redeem” and wait for the pop-up. If the code’s active, the rewards show up right away.

That’s it. No secret handshake, no dev console, just a straight shot—if you know where to click.
